Output 61310e3c834ee2fbe565105b3140a42551102b1306b817726c4c325245008281:1

value
3161264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52fb539ecfc94b7f4157cc0a07c6ec012e39339f OP_EQUALVERIFY OP_CHECKSIG
address
18ZmVDFt5ottq9A3TeoeeLyuSDZScSENAb
transaction
61310e3c834ee2fbe565105b3140a42551102b1306b817726c4c325245008281
confirmations
296893
spent
true